Transaction ed881df7b953c0750fbdbf1cde55a3a7cfcc0c2ccdaa82a0be20301eec5fdb45
1 Input
1 Outputs
- ed881df7b953c0750fbdbf1cde55a3a7cfcc0c2ccdaa82a0be20301eec5fdb45:0
value 1220460
address 3HuNaT913aM3hQahPNAnnswVaHTLfSuJcE